The NFF have appointed 58-year-old German Bruno Labbadia as the new coach of the Super Eagles.
He will lead the team against Benin and Rwanda in 2025 AFCON qualifiers next month.
Nigeria welcome Benin to Uyo on September 7, before a trip to Rwanda three days later.
NFF general secretary Mohammed Sanusi confirmed the appointment.
“The NFF Executive Committee has approved the recommendation of its technical and development sub-committee to appoint Mr Bruno Labbadia as the head coach of the Super Eagles,” he announced in a statement.
“The appointment is with immediate effect.”
Labbadia has handled several top Bundesliga clubs like VfB Stuttgart, Bayer Leverkusen and Wolfsburg.

Atalanta coach: Ademola Lookman and I friends again

Atalanta coach Gian Piero Gasperini has said he and Ademola Lookman have made up after the recent rift following his comments for the player’s missed penalty in a UEFA Champions League tie.
